2012-09-13 2 views
-1

나는 내 컴퓨터에 웹 서버를 호스팅 할 간단한 요구 사항이 있습니다. 그러나 유감스럽게도 고용주가 제공하는 인터넷 연결에는 포트가 열려 있습니다. & 80입니다. 나머지 모든 포트는 닫힙니다. 포트 80과 21 포트 포워딩을 시도했지만 그들은 이미 내 고용주가 사용하고 있습니다. 그렇다면 내 컴퓨터에 웹 서버를 호스팅하는 다른 방법이 있습니까?포트 포워딩

추신 : 저는 Apache와 함께 리눅스를 사용 중입니다.

+1

맞춤 포트에서 웹 서버를 실행해야하는 경우 고용주가 해당 포트를 열어서는 안됩니까? 아니면 그것에 대해 알지 못한 상태에서 웹 서버를 실행하려고합니까? –

+0

@ JoachimPileborg : 제안에 감사드립니다. 고용주가 알지 못하면 그것을 실행하려고합니다. – kasa

답변

0

방화벽이 HTTP 프록시를 실행합니까 아니면 단순한 포트 전달자입니까? 프록시 인 경우 가상 웹 호스트 작동 방식과 마찬가지로 Host: 헤더를 기반으로 다른 내부 IP로 전달할 수 있습니다.

그렇지 않으면이 포트를 사용할 수 없습니다. NAT 라우터는 포트를 하나의 IP로만 전달할 수 있습니다. 웹 서버를 호스팅하는 것이 요구 사항이라면, 네트워크 관리자에게 연락하여 다른 포트를 열어 볼 수 있어야합니다. 그들이 귀하의 요청에 따라 그것을하지 않을 경우, 귀하의 관리자는 요구 사항을 확인할 수 있어야합니다.

+0

HTTP 프록시를 통해 인터넷에 연결할 수 있습니다. 호스트 헤더를 기반으로 전달하는 방법을 설명 할 수 있습니까? 링크조차 할 것입니다. – kasa

+0

이것은 방화벽 관리자가해야 할 일입니다. 그것은 방화벽의 문서에 있어야합니다. – Barmar

+0

감사합니다. @Barmar. 나는 그것을 관리자와 함께 가져갈 것이다. – kasa

관련 문제